What factors affect the price to rent a jumper?

Several factors influence the rental price of a jumper (bounce house). The most significant are the size and type of jumper, the rental duration, the location of the event, and any additional services or features included.

Beyond the core factors, the *size and type* directly impact the cost because larger, more elaborate jumpers, like those with slides or obstacle courses, require more material, maintenance, and potentially more staff for setup and supervision. The *rental duration* is straightforward – renting for a full day will generally cost more than renting for just a few hours. *Location* matters due to delivery costs, fuel expenses, and the potential for higher insurance premiums in certain areas. Companies also factor in their own operational costs, including insurance, cleaning, repairs, and labor. Lastly, optional add-ons and seasonal demand influence pricing. For example, renting during peak season (summer weekends, holidays) typically commands higher prices. Some companies offer packages that include extras like generators (if power isn't readily available), attendants to supervise children, or even themed decorations. These extras will increase the overall cost of the rental. Weather conditions can also play a role, with some companies offering weather-related cancellation policies or price adjustments.

What's the average cost to rent a jumper for a day?

The average cost to rent a standard-sized bounce house or jumper for a day typically ranges from $100 to $300. However, this price can fluctuate significantly based on several factors, including the size and complexity of the jumper, its features (like slides or water features), the rental duration, and the location of the rental company.

The size of the jumper plays a crucial role in determining the rental cost. Smaller, basic bounce houses suitable for younger children will generally be on the lower end of the price range. Larger, more elaborate jumpers, especially those with obstacle courses, slides, or water features, will command higher prices. Also, rental companies often offer packages that include delivery, setup, and takedown, which are factored into the overall cost. Location also affects pricing. Areas with a higher cost of living or greater demand for party rentals may have higher jumper rental rates. Rental companies in more remote areas might charge extra for delivery if the location is outside their standard service area. It's always a good idea to get quotes from multiple rental companies to compare prices and services before making a decision. Booking in advance, especially during peak season, can also help secure a better price and ensure availability.

Are there extra fees besides the base jumper rental price?

Yes, in addition to the base jumper (bounce house) rental price, you can typically expect to encounter extra fees. These commonly include delivery fees, setup fees, taxes, and potentially fees for additional services such as generators if power isn't readily available at the event location, or extended rental time beyond the standard period.

Many rental companies incorporate a delivery fee, which varies based on the distance to the event location from their warehouse. Setup fees cover the labor involved in properly inflating, securing, and taking down the jumper, ensuring safety and stability throughout the rental period. Don’t forget about applicable state and local sales taxes, which will always be added to the base rental price. Depending on the specific needs of your event, you may also incur additional costs. For example, if your event runs late and you want to extend the rental period, an hourly extension fee will usually apply. Also, if the location doesn't have easy access to electricity, you might need to rent a generator to power the blower that keeps the jumper inflated. Clarifying these potential additional fees with the rental company before booking is crucial to avoid any unexpected expenses and to ensure you have a clear understanding of the total cost.

How much does jumper size impact rental costs?

Jumper size directly and significantly impacts rental costs. Larger jumpers require more material, are more difficult to transport and set up, and often accommodate more users, increasing wear and tear and therefore the rental price.

Larger jumpers necessitate a greater initial investment for rental companies, which translates to higher rental fees. They need more durable materials to withstand increased use and larger physical footprints which, in turn, may require larger vehicles for transportation and more manpower for setup and takedown. Insurance costs might also be higher for larger units due to the increased risk associated with more users and potential accidents. Furthermore, bigger jumpers frequently come with additional features, like slides, climbing walls, or basketball hoops, which also factor into the overall cost. The increased entertainment value justifies a higher price point. Conversely, smaller, basic jumpers are cheaper to rent due to their lower initial cost, ease of transportation, and reduced risk.

Do jumper rental companies require a deposit?

Yes, most jumper rental companies require a deposit. This deposit acts as a security measure to protect the company against potential damage to the jumper, late returns, or cancellations made close to the event date. The deposit amount can vary considerably depending on several factors, including the size and type of jumper, the rental duration, and the specific policies of the rental company.

The deposit amount typically ranges from a small percentage of the total rental cost (e.g., 10-20%) to a fixed sum, such as $50 or $100. For larger, more elaborate inflatables, or rentals that span multiple days, the deposit is likely to be higher. It's crucial to inquire about the deposit policy upfront and carefully review the rental agreement to understand the terms and conditions surrounding the deposit refund. Generally, the deposit is refundable, provided the jumper is returned in good condition, on time, and the rental agreement's terms haven't been violated. However, some companies may have non-refundable cancellation fees if you cancel your booking within a certain timeframe of the event. Therefore, always clarify the refund policy and any potential deductions beforehand to avoid any surprises.

Is it cheaper to rent a jumper during the week versus the weekend?

Yes, it is generally cheaper to rent a jumper (bounce house) during the week compared to the weekend. This is due to higher demand and peak usage typically occurring on Saturdays and Sundays when most parties and events take place.

Rental companies operate on supply and demand. Weekends are their busiest times, allowing them to charge premium rates. During the week, demand is lower, leading to lower prices to incentivize rentals. Many companies offer discounted rates for weekday rentals to maximize the utilization of their inventory. You can often find substantial savings by choosing a Monday through Thursday rental date. To maximize your savings, it's always best to call around and compare prices from different rental companies. Be sure to ask about any weekday specials or discounts they may offer. Flexibility with your rental date can often lead to significant cost reductions. Also, consider that some companies may have minimum rental periods that could impact the overall price, so clarify those details upfront.

Are there discounts for renting a jumper for multiple days?

Yes, most jumper rental companies offer discounts for multi-day rentals. The exact discount will vary depending on the company, the specific jumper model, and the length of the rental period, but it's generally more cost-effective to rent a jumper for multiple days than to rent it for single days consecutively.

The reason jumper rental companies offer multi-day discounts is primarily due to logistical efficiencies. Setting up and taking down a jumper involves labor and transportation costs. Renting for multiple days allows the company to spread those fixed costs over a longer period, resulting in lower average daily expenses. They pass these savings on to the customer as an incentive for longer rentals. To determine the specific discount you can expect, it's best to contact the rental company directly and inquire about their multi-day rates. Be sure to ask if the discount is automatically applied or if you need to request it specifically. Some companies might offer a percentage discount (e.g., 10% off the daily rate for each additional day), while others may have pre-defined multi-day packages with set prices.
